5 Secrets to Becoming a Successful Property Management Company

Normal 1492711857 Becoming Successful Property Manager Bay Management Group

1. Be Dependable

Your property owners hire you because they want you to manage all things property related. If you cannot be depended on to handle everything that comes your way in regards to your clients’ rental properties, you can guarantee they will not keep paying you to manage their properties.

This means you need to be fully invested in each property you manage. Handling things such as rent collection, evictions, property maintenance and repairs, and much more cannot happen at your convenience. Your job is to handle these items, and anything else required of you by both tenant and property owner, quickly and effectively.

2. Become a Marketer

As a property management company, it is you and your team’s responsibility to market the vacant properties of your clients. This means understanding the current market, the rental properties you manage, and the amenities prospective tenants hope to find available in rentals in your area.

Here are the best ways to improve your marketing skills:

  • Stay up to date on current market statistics
  • Know what properties similar to your clients’ are leasing for and adjust accordingly
  • Create connections with various ad agencies
  • Advertise vacancies across many platforms
  • Learn what makes a successful vacancy ad and follow through with what you have learned
  • Invest in a marketing strategy that brings results

The quicker you can get vacancies filled, the more satisfied your property owners will be. This in turn will make them a customer for life and may even lead to referrals that can help you build your business.

3. Have a Solid Team

It matters a great deal who you hire. Experienced property managers, those who understand the rental property laws, and friendly staff that keep the office running smoothly are going to make all the difference when it comes to your company’s success.

It is also important to be able to delegate responsibilities to various team members. This way, one property manager does not become overwhelmed and begin to falter. Consider hiring a dedicated property manager, a property manager assistant, and a leasing agent. The property manager can handle all serious matters, the assistant can handle all current tenant inquiries, and the leasing agent can help place new tenants in available properties. Teamwork, knowledge, and experience are the keys to success in property management.

4. Know the Laws

As mentioned above, understanding all landlord-tenant laws and regulations at the federal, state, and local levels will not only brand you as a trustworthy company to employ, but will keep you out of trouble when it comes to landlord-tenant disputes.

As the property manager, it is your job to deal with legal matters related to the properties you oversee. This may include things like evictions, property damage, breach of lease agreements, and any other issues your tenant may have. Learn the language of lease provisions, understand proper rent collection procedures and the rules regarding security deposits, and take a refresher on housing discrimination to ensure that you are not at fault should a legal dispute arise. After all, this is what your property owners pay you to do.

5. Stay Organized

Organized and legally complaint recordkeeping is one of the key tasks all successful property management companies do well. You are responsible for collecting management fees from property owners and rent payments from tenants. You approve maintenance requests and repairs, pay your own employees, and have tax issues to deal with each year regarding your own business.

Try using an online payment collection process, invest in software that will keep all the finances in one place, hire a reputable accountant to manage the books, and last of all remain completely transparent with your property owners. This way, should any dispute arise, you can defend your business, or should any audit by the IRS pop up you can rest assured you are okay.
